Touch Down Football League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 65,315 | 53,711 | 11,604 | 35.1 | 0% |
| 2012 | 74,729 | 65,764 | 8,965 | 30.3 | 0% |
| 2013 | 72,079 | 66,865 | 5,214 | 30.7 | 0% |
| 2014 | 64,608 | 63,038 | 1,570 | 32.9 | 0% |
| 2015 | 53,759 | 62,417 | −8,658 | 31.5 | 0% |
| 2016 | 42,833 | 54,015 | −11,182 | 34.0 | 0% |
| 2017 | 66,532 | 57,772 | 8,760 | 33.6 | 0% |
| 2018 | 54,067 | 53,056 | 1,011 | 36.8 | 0% |
| 2019 | 75,391 | 73,786 | 1,605 | 26.7 | — |
| 2020 | 1,134 | 10,725 | −9,591 | 173.7 | — |
| 2021 | 71,534 | 62,034 | 9,500 | 31.9 | — |
| 2022 | 58,701 | 58,890 | −189 | 33.5 | — |
| 2023 | 105,224 | 72,166 | 33,058 | 32.9 | — |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$33,058 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 32.9 months of spending, down from 35.1 in 2011.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ash.
